THE PARK LEVER ON THE INVOLVED VEHICLES CONTAINS A DEFECTIVE SPRING WHICH COULD PREVENT AUTOMATIC ENGAGEMENT OF THE PARKING GEAR.
THE PARK ACTUATING LEVER ROD SPRING WILL BE REPLACED WITH AN UPGRADED SPRING WITHOUT CHARGE TO OWNER
